WebPerforming cardiovascular exercises will increase your heart rate and make you breathe faster. It will also help to improve your lung functionality and strengthen your heart! Some great workouts are: Cycling. Jogging. Swimming. Dancing. Aerobics. Contact your doctor before making a dramatic change to your exercise regimen. WebAs I have come to understand (from a few years of cycling training / racing) you cannot increase your lung capacity. The volume of air your lungs can take in is a fixed quantity based on genetics (how big your lungs are.) What you can do is 1) Increase the efficiency that your muscles use oxygen and 2) Increase the efficiency that your cardio ...
